Skip to content

Governance

šŸ“š Enterprise Documentation Engine

  • Toda alteração estrutural (schema, contratos de API, fluxos crĆ­ticos ou governanƧa) exige atualização da documentação em /docs.
  • O snapshot de schema Ć© gerado automaticamente por scripts/generate-schema-snapshot.js via leitura da view vw_schema_snapshot.
  • PRs sem atualização documental obrigatória devem ser considerados invĆ”lidos.
  • O pipeline de docs em .github/workflows/docs.yml executa geração de snapshot + build + deploy para GitHub Pages.
  • Para o deploy de docs funcionar, os secrets SUPABASE_URL e SUPABASE_SERVICE_ROLE_KEY devem existir no repositório (Settings → Secrets and variables → Actions).

Operação

  1. Atualize os arquivos de especificação em /docs.
  2. Gere snapshot local (quando necessƔrio): bash node scripts/generate-schema-snapshot.js
  3. Valide o build: bash mkdocs build